Types of Doors Installed by Experts
Professionals can direct property owners and services in choosing the right type of door for their requirements. Here is a summary of typically installed doors:
Door Type
Description
Entry Doors
The first impression of a home or service, using security and style.
Interior Doors
Utilized within a property, these doors can be practical or ornamental.
Moving Doors
Suitable for smaller areas, they slide open rather of swinging.
Bi-fold Doors
Typically used in closets, they fold outwards, conserving space.
French Doors
Double doors that open external, including sophistication and light.
Storm Doors
Deal additional security versus climate condition while permitting ventilation.
Garage Doors
Generally bigger, either by hand operated or automated for benefit.

What to Expect During the Installation Process
Understanding the door installation process can assist house owners know what to expect and facilitate smoother communication with the installers. Here's a quick overview of what typically takes place:
Consultation: A preliminary meeting to go over design preferences, budget, and the type of door.
Measurements: Accurate measurements of the door frame to ensure an ideal fit.
Choosing Materials: Selection of the ideal materials (wood, metal, fiberglass) based upon durability and design.
Removal of Old Doors: If relevant, mindful elimination of the existing door while decreasing damage to the frame.
Installation of the New Door: Using specialized tools, professionals install the new door, ensuring it opens and closes efficiently.
Final Adjustments: Making modifications to hinges, locks, and locks for optimal performance.
Clean-up: A responsible specialist will clean the area after installation.
FAQs About Door Installation
1. The length of time does it usually take to set up a door?
- Installation can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ending upon the type of door and the intricacy of the installation.
2. What is the average cost of door installation?
- Costs vary commonly based on products and labor, but house owners can usually expect to pay in between ₤ 300 and ₤ 1,000 per door.
3. Do I require a permit for door installation?
- This depends on local building regulations. Constantly contact your local town regarding authorization requirements.
